Output 28aeb67d343402f74a8aa91a4df62d4b269717406b7f89c08a3783b24e3d4c5a:3

value
31417082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400a9c315994de260e8bb8ca874b031c870f3a5c OP_EQUAL
address
MDjnBur4nL1nE2pEDYyX1jZE8XXJ2oPGT2
transaction
28aeb67d343402f74a8aa91a4df62d4b269717406b7f89c08a3783b24e3d4c5a
spent
true